Transaction eec22f621426a0fcab2675c9811d39a3c4580845f59f750fae3f627f137b6210

block
2acf9f54a28d0d30c4f0a144434a21cf299de6660fc9b01a702b782b6c669eaf

1 Input

2 Outputs